Understanding What Medicine Is Prescribed For ADD?

Attention Deficit Disorder (ADD) is a neurodevelopmental condition characterized by symptoms such as inattention, distractibility, and sometimes impulsivity. While ADD is often grouped under the broader category of Attention Deficit Hyperactivity Disorder (ADHD), it specifically refers to the inattentive presentation without the hyperactive component. Treatment revolves primarily around medication to help manage symptoms and improve daily functioning. Knowing what medicine is prescribed for ADD is crucial for patients, caregivers, and healthcare providers aiming for effective management.

Medications prescribed for ADD typically fall into two major categories: stimulant and non-stimulant drugs. These medicines work by altering brain chemistry to enhance concentration, reduce distractibility, and improve impulse control. The choice of medication depends on various factors including age, symptom severity, co-existing conditions, and individual response to treatment.

Stimulant Medications: The Cornerstone of ADD Treatment

Stimulants are the most commonly prescribed medications for ADD. They have been used for decades due to their proven effectiveness in improving attention span and reducing impulsivity. Stimulants work by increasing the levels of certain neurotransmitters in the brain—primarily dopamine and norepinephrine—which play key roles in attention regulation and executive function.

The two main types of stimulant medications are methylphenidate-based and amphetamine-based drugs.

Methylphenidate-Based Stimulants

Methylphenidate is one of the oldest and most widely used stimulant medications. It comes in various formulations including immediate-release (IR), extended-release (ER), and long-acting versions. These options allow tailored dosing schedules to suit individual needs.

Common methylphenidate medications include:

    • Ritalin
    • Concerta
    • Metadate
    • Methylin

Methylphenidate improves attention by blocking the reuptake of dopamine and norepinephrine into neurons, increasing their availability in the brain’s synapses.

Amphetamine-Based Stimulants

Amphetamines also increase dopamine and norepinephrine but through slightly different mechanisms involving both release promotion and reuptake inhibition. They tend to have a longer duration of action compared to some methylphenidate formulations.

Popular amphetamine-based medicines include:

    • Adderall
    • Vyvanse
    • Dextroamphetamine (Dexedrine)

Vyvanse is unique as a prodrug—it becomes active only after digestion—offering a smoother onset with less abuse potential.

Non-Stimulant Medications: Alternatives When Stimulants Aren’t Suitable

Not everyone responds well to stimulants or can tolerate their side effects such as insomnia, appetite loss, or increased heart rate. Non-stimulant medications provide an alternative route with different mechanisms of action.

Atomoxetine (Strattera)

Atomoxetine is a selective norepinephrine reuptake inhibitor (NRI). It increases norepinephrine levels without directly affecting dopamine pathways like stimulants do. Atomoxetine tends to have a slower onset—taking several weeks before noticeable effects—and may be preferred when there’s concern about stimulant abuse or comorbid anxiety.

Alpha-2 Adrenergic Agonists

Medications such as guanfacine (Intuniv) and clonidine (Kapvay) originally developed as blood pressure drugs are also used off-label or approved for ADD management. They work by stimulating alpha-2 receptors in the brain which helps regulate attention and impulse control through modulation of noradrenergic activity.

These drugs are often combined with stimulants or used alone if stimulants cause intolerable side effects.

Dosing Strategies and Monitoring for ADD Medications

Prescribing medicine for ADD isn’t a one-size-fits-all process. Physicians start with low doses and gradually adjust based on therapeutic response and side effects. The goal is to find the lowest effective dose that improves symptoms without causing unacceptable adverse reactions.

Regular follow-ups are critical to monitor effectiveness, side effects, growth parameters in children, cardiovascular health, and potential misuse risks. Medication holidays may be recommended occasionally to assess ongoing need or reduce tolerance buildup.

The Role of Combination Therapy

Sometimes a single medication doesn’t fully control symptoms. In such cases, combining stimulant with non-stimulant drugs may be beneficial under strict medical supervision. This approach aims to maximize symptom relief while minimizing side effects from high doses of any one drug.

A Comparative Look at Common ADD Medications

Medication Type Main Examples Key Features & Considerations
Methylphenidate Stimulants Ritalin, Concerta, Metadate Rapid onset; multiple formulations; effective in 70-80% cases; side effects include insomnia & appetite loss
Amphetamine Stimulants Adderall, Vyvanse, Dexedrine Longer duration; Vyvanse has lower abuse potential; similar effectiveness; watch for cardiovascular effects
Non-Stimulants Atomoxetine (Strattera), Guanfacine (Intuniv), Clonidine (Kapvay) Slower onset; good option if stimulants contraindicated; may cause fatigue or low blood pressure

The Science Behind How These Medicines Work in ADD Brains

ADD involves dysregulation in brain circuits responsible for attention control—primarily within the prefrontal cortex—and neurotransmitter imbalances involving dopamine and norepinephrine. Both stimulant and non-stimulant medications aim to restore balance within these neural pathways but do so differently:

    • Stimulants: Boost dopamine/norepinephrine signaling quickly by blocking reuptake or increasing release.
    • NRI Atomoxetine:: Selectively blocks norepinephrine reuptake leading to enhanced noradrenergic tone.
    • Alpha-2 Agonists:: Modulate receptor activity that regulates attention networks indirectly via noradrenergic pathways.

This neurochemical tuning translates into improved focus, decreased distractibility, better working memory function, and reduced impulsivity—the hallmark improvements sought when deciding what medicine is prescribed for ADD.

Tackling Side Effects: What Patients Should Know About ADD Medications

All medications carry risks alongside benefits—and those prescribed for ADD are no exception. Common side effects vary somewhat between drug classes:

    • Methylphenidate & Amphetamines:: Insomnia, decreased appetite leading to weight loss, increased heart rate or blood pressure, mood swings.
    • Atomoxetine:: Fatigue or drowsiness initially; possible gastrointestinal upset; rare risk of liver toxicity.
    • Alpha-2 Agonists:: Sedation especially at start; dizziness due to lowered blood pressure.

Patients must communicate openly with their healthcare provider about any troubling symptoms so doses can be adjusted or alternative treatments considered promptly.

The Role of Age When Considering What Medicine Is Prescribed For ADD?

Age plays a significant role both in diagnosis confirmation as well as medication selection:

    • Younger Children:: Non-stimulant options might be preferred initially due to sensitivity concerns.
    • Youths & Adolescents:: Stimulants remain first-line treatment given robust evidence supporting efficacy.
    • Adults With Late Diagnosis:: Often benefit from similar regimens but require cardiovascular screening beforehand.

Physicians weigh developmental stage carefully because dosing requirements differ widely between children and adults along with monitoring protocols.

Tackling Misconceptions About What Medicine Is Prescribed For ADD?

Several myths surround medication use for ADD:

    • “ADD meds cause addiction.” This is generally false when taken correctly under medical supervision; misuse can lead to dependency but therapeutic use minimizes this risk significantly.
    • “Medication changes personality.”This misconception arises when dosage isn’t optimized; proper treatment aims only at symptom control without altering core personality traits.
    • “Only kids take medicine.”Additionally untrue—many adults benefit from appropriate pharmacotherapy well into adulthood.
    • “Natural remedies suffice.”Certain supplements may support brain function but lack strong evidence replacing prescription medicines proven effective over decades.
